In the beginning, you'll need to remove the chrome cover from the key fob. Use the emergency key blade to remove the body of key fob. Install a brand new CR2032 battery into the key fob with the positive side facing upwards. Slide or snap the cover into place. Be sure to handle the new battery carefully by not touching its bottom and top faces could transfer moisture and promote corrosion. You should also clean your hands prior to handling a brand new battery to avoid contaminating the contacts.
